description

The Department for Education (DfE) is looking to commission research to improve the department's understanding of future building safety risks and condition issues in the education estate, in particular in post-war buildings (constructed between 1945 and 1990).

The multi-disciplinary research will include:

Desk-based analysis.
Intrusive structural surveys* and qualitative research in a representative sample of post-war buildings to reflect different construction type, material, age, and degrees of maintenance.
Modelling to map the prevalence of future structural risks and condition issues across the post-war estate.
Exploration of technology and innovations to understand structural risks including potential use of machine learning artificial intelligence modelling to process high volumes of data to identify and learn specific types of defects experienced in older buildings associated by age and typology with cross reference to condition data to predict the likely nature(s) of building deterioration.
Key observable characteristics of structural risks.
Policy recommendations on mitigating future risks.

*DfE will separately procure works to facilitate intrusive surveys (including opening up locations to access the structural frame; safe handling and removal of asbestos where required; on and off-site testing of samples). Funds for this will come from the department's overall budget associated with this project. The lead supplier will be responsible for ensuring a full specification of the works required is designed and liaise with the DfE Older Buildings team, the 'minor works' contractor and participating schools once appointed.
